Ayodeji Bamidele Stars as Power Dynamos Stun Rivers United in CAF Champions League

Former Shooting Stars Defender, Samuel Ayodeji Bamidele delivered an outstanding performance as Power Dynamos recorded a famous 1–0 away victory over Rivers United on Matchday Four of the TotalEnergies CAF Champions League group stage on Sunday.

The Zambian champions produced a disciplined and resilient display at the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ium to claim all three points, dealing a blow to Rivers United’s qualification hopes.

Central to that effort was Bamidele, who marshalled the backline superbly, making crucial interceptions, clearances and well-timed tackles to keep the hosts at bay.

After a cagey first half with few clear-cut chances, the decisive moment arrived five minutes into the second half.

Kondwani Chiboni broke the deadlock in the 50th minute, firing home from a tight angle after a well-weighted assist from Prince Mumba.

The goal stunned the home crowd and shifted the momentum firmly in favour of Power Dynamos.

Rivers United pushed forward in search of an equaliser, but they were repeatedly frustrated by Power Dynamos’ compact defensive shape and Bamidele’s commanding presence at the heart of defence.

Despite late pressure and several attacking substitutions, the Nigerian champions could not find a way past the visitors.

The result sees Power Dynamos strengthen their position in the group, while Rivers United are left with work to do in the remaining fixtures.

For Bamidele and his teammates, it was a statement performance on the continental stage, underlining their ability to compete and win away from home in Africa’s elite club competition.
